在做CSS设计的过程中,我一直想知道一些事情.
css宽度中的小数位是否受到尊重?或者他们四舍五入?
.percentage
{
width: 49.5%;
}
Run Code Online (Sandbox Code Playgroud)
要么
.pixel
{
width: 122.5px;
}
Run Code Online (Sandbox Code Playgroud) 有没有办法以一种影响所有泛型类的方式在C#中的以下异常中获取给定键的值?我认为这是微软的异常描述中的一个重大缺失.
"The given key was not present in the dictionary."
Run Code Online (Sandbox Code Playgroud)
更好的方法是:
"The given key '" + key.ToString() + "' was not present in the dictionary."
Run Code Online (Sandbox Code Playgroud)
解决方案可能涉及mixins或派生类.
我们有一个150多个表的设计,在.dbml布局中到处都有行,很难找到单独的表.
有没有办法在dbml布局中搜索而不是滚动试图找到一个表(Ctrl + F不起作用),运行Visual Studio 2010 Ultimate?
我在Firefox中的功能存在很大问题,它保留了用户在重新加载时填写的数据F5.如果我使用Ctrl+ F5表格被清除,这很好.我的问题是并非所有用户都知道这是强制输入清理所必须做的.是否有一种方法在html或响应头中告诉Firefox不保留表单中的数据?
有没有办法只用这个CSS影响可见元素?
table.grid tr.alt:nth-child(odd)
{
background:#ebeff4;
}
table.grid tr.alt:nth-child(even)
{
background:#ffffff;
}
Run Code Online (Sandbox Code Playgroud)
如果我使用$('select some tr:s').hide()隐藏了一些行,我会得到奇怪和均匀样式的混合,但所有这些都在混合中.
有没有办法在谷歌浏览器中禁用和替换快捷命令.我想将Chrome用于只能访问一个站点的公共计算机.因此,我想禁用Ctrl+ Tab,Ctrl+ T,Alt+ F4等键,我想更改F11为Ctrl+ Shift+ Alt+ J(示例)等命令,以阻止用户退出全屏模式.
网络上的设置会阻止除特定域之外的所有内容,但现在我想阻止用户退出浏览器.
BR安德烈亚斯
我有一些看起来像这样的代码可以正常工作:
var info = [];
for (i = 0; i < 10; i++)
{
info[i] = $('#info_' + i).val();
}
Run Code Online (Sandbox Code Playgroud)
问题是这种模式在我的应用程序中很常见,但有一些细微的变化.我想做的是使这成为一个像这样的oneliner,其中info成为一个数组:
var info = $('[id^="info_"]').each().val();
Run Code Online (Sandbox Code Playgroud) 我想要做的是创建一个简单的日历,我想找到特定月份的第一周的第一天.我的日历是星期一 - >星期日日历,以下代码有效,但正如您所看到的那样,它并不是那么好.任何人都可以更好地了解如何在日历中获得第一个日期.
var now = new DateTime(Year, Month, 1);
now = now.AddDays(1-(int)now.DayOfWeek);
now = now.Day > 15 ? now : now.AddDays(-7);
Run Code Online (Sandbox Code Playgroud)
日历最终看起来像这样:
| < | Jan 2011 | > |
------------------------------------
| Mo | Tu | We | Th | Fr | Sa | Su |
|[27]| 28 | 29 | 30 | 31 | 01 | 02 |
| 03 | 04 | 05 | 06 | 07 | 08 | 09 |
| .. | .. | …Run Code Online (Sandbox Code Playgroud) 有没有办法通过知道变量的名称来获取变量的值,如下所示:
double temp = (double)MyClass.GetValue("VariableName");
Run Code Online (Sandbox Code Playgroud)
当我通常会像这样访问变量时
double temp = MyClass.VariableName;
Run Code Online (Sandbox Code Playgroud) 我想在SQL Server中创建一个过程来选择和连接两个表.@company,@ from和@to参数始终设置,但@serie_type可以为NULL.如果@serie_type不是NULL我只想包含指定的类型,简单AND S.Type = @serie_type,但如果@serie_type为NULL我想包含所有类型,简单,只是不包括AND语句.我的问题是,我不知道是否会设置@serie_type因此我希望o有这样的事情:
/* pseudocode */
??? = AND (IF @serie_type IS NOT NULL S.Type = @serie_type)
Run Code Online (Sandbox Code Playgroud)
这是一个简化的程序版本:
CREATE PROCEDURE Report_CompanySerie
@company INT,
@serie_type INT,
@from DATE,
@to DATE
AS
BEGIN
SELECT
*
FROM Company C
JOIN Series S ON S.Company_FK = C.Id
WHERE C.Id = @company
AND S.Created >= @from
AND S.Created <= @to
/* HERE IS MY PROBLEM */
AND ???
END
GO
Run Code Online (Sandbox Code Playgroud)
不想复制选择因为真正的选择比这更大.